G AS 2014: Technological potential of oilseed safflower
The G AS 2014 safflower variety, developed by the Russian Research and Design Technological Institute of Sorghum and Maize, is a highly specialized tool for farmers operating in high-risk agricultural zones. The primary engineering challenge addressed by the breeders was to create a crop with high adaptability to arid conditions while maintaining a stable yield of marketable oil.
Agrobiological parameters and oil content
The key performance indicator for G AS 2014 lies in the selective control of seed composition. With an oil content of 35–40%, the variety demonstrates an optimal balance between vegetative biomass and lipid accumulation. For agricultural producers, this translates into:
- Predictability of the oil extraction process due to the uniformity of the seed material.
- Reduced drying costs during harvesting, as the plant's physiology is optimized for accelerated moisture release in the final maturation phase.
- High drought resistance, allowing for minimized crop failure risks in conditions of moisture deficit.
The development, led by experts V.I. Zhuzhukin, V.S. Gorbunov, and S.V. Suslov, focused not only on yield but also on harvesting efficiency. G AS 2014 features a plant architecture that allows for the use of standard combine headers with minimal adjustment, which is crucial for adhering to strict agricultural timelines.
The economic rationale for choosing G AS 2014
Selecting this variety is a commitment to stability. Unlike less refined populations, G AS 2014 exhibits a predictable response to agricultural inputs. Patent protection (held by the Institute, V.S. Gorbunov, S.V. Suslov, and O.A. Alekseev) guarantees varietal purity and compliance with the declared specifications, which is critical for long-term crop rotation planning in steppe and forest-steppe regions.
